Dr Daini Ong

Dr Dai Ni Ong is an Ophthalmologist with a special interest in cataract surgery and macular degeneration. She offers medical consultation and surgery for a wide range of general ophthalmic conditions.

She operates in surgery centres with the latest equipment and caring staff. Dr Ong regularly attends conferences to keep up to date with the latest innovations in cataract surgery.

Dr Ong is also a retinal specialist. She has performed over a thousand of anti-VEGF injections for macular degeneration and other retinal diseases. She has helped many patients to improve and maintain their vision.

Dr Ong graduated with honours from Monash University Medical School, Melbourne. She then worked at The Austin Hospital, Melbourne where she received “The Best Hospital Medical Officer Teacher Award”.

After completing her ophthalmology training at The Royal Victorian Eye and Ear Hospital, Melbourne, she moved to the UK for further training in medical retina and uveitis conditions at the prestigious Moorfields Hospital, London. She undertook further training in glaucoma and oculoplastics at The Royal Devon and Exeter Hospital. Other fellowship training included cataract surgery at The Royal Victorian Eye and Ear Hospital, Melbourne.

Dr Suheb Ahmed is an ‘Eye Surgeon’ or ophthalmologist who completed his undergraduate and specialist training from Scotland. At Maryvale Private Hospital he specialises in Cataract surgery, Pterygium and Glaucoma management.  He offers the latest in cataract surgery techniques and the latest in intraocular lenses. He is a high volume surgeon and his safety record is exceptional.

He also offers the latest in minimally invasive glaucoma procedures (MIGS) and was the first in Gippsland to offer it. Maryvale Hospital was the first and currently the only hospital in Gippsland where you can have MIGS procedures.
